diff --git a/cmd/backoffice/fileserver.go b/cmd/backoffice/fileserver.go index 0480f8a..ad7602d 100644 --- a/cmd/backoffice/fileserver.go +++ b/cmd/backoffice/fileserver.go @@ -147,6 +147,7 @@ func (fs *FileServer) CartHandler(w http.ResponseWriter, r *http.Request) { id, ok := isValidId(idStr) if !ok { writeJSON(w, http.StatusBadRequest, JsonError{Error: "invalid id"}) + return } // reconstruct state from event log if present grain := cart.NewCartGrain(id, time.Now())